Subject: Partner SFTP drop — new owner

Hi,

As you review the pending changes to the Harborline ingest scripts, note that ownership of the partner SFTP drop is changing at the end of the month. This includes key rotation, the nightly pull job, and the quarantine folder for malformed files. Review comments on the retry logic should still go through the normal PR flow, but questions about drop-folder conventions or partner onboarding now go to the new owner. The incoming owner is listed below.

signatory, tagaf-bahaf: Praael Fenmir Rusok

## Break-Glass Access: Sweepline Orphan Sweeper

If Sweepline begins deleting resources still referenced by the Calyx scheduler, halt the sweeper immediately via the admin toggle. Normal credentials rotate hourly; during a halt, rotation pauses and the break-glass path is the only way in. Confirm the incident channel is notified, record the timestamp in the sweep ledger, then unlock the emergency console. The recovery passphrase for the break-glass account is as follows.

strongbox words: zorwyn-sorael-belion-ulaius-silmir-ulays-briax-rusdor-gorix

## Releases

AddrSnap, the address autocomplete widget from Quillmark Labs, ships tagged releases every six weeks. Plugin authors should pin to a minor version and test against the release candidate published one week prior. All release artifacts are signed before upload, and plugins must verify signatures at install time. Verify each download against the current public signing key shown below.

deploy key for kajeg-kawip: bky19_uuRdFa6en9FVy2fJHhU

Subject: Font vendoring cut-over — done

Team, the cut-over is complete. All typefaces for the Larkspur design system are now vendored in-repo; the external font CDN dependency is removed. Page loads dropped ~120ms at p50 and the flash-of-unstyled-text reports have stopped. No rollback expected. The serving config now in production is listed below.

settings of fajop-fahap:
[holeth]
port = 9300
team = juleth
host = holeth.tolvaqsoft.example
region = south-4
access_code = ac_4bcdf6
timeout_ms = 500